#include <vtkImageDataGeometryFilter.h>
#include <vtkPolyDataMapper.h>
#include <vtkActor.h>
#include <vtkRenderer.h>
#include <vtkRenderWindow.h>
#include <vtkRenderWindowInteractor.h>
#include <vtkAutoInit.h> // 开始的时候一直报异常,vtk9.0 显示报错,需加上此头文件
VTK_MODULE_INIT(vtkRenderingOpenGL2);//vtk9.0 显示报错,需加上此宏定义
VTK_MODULE_INIT(vtkInteractionStyle);//vtk9.0 显示报错,需加上此宏定义
VTK_MODULE_INIT(vtkRenderingFreeType);//vtk9.0 显示报错,需加上此宏定义
vtkSmartPointer<vtkImageDataGeometryFilter> ImageToPolydata0 = vtkSmartPointer<vtkImageDataGeometryFilter>::New();
ImageToPolydata0->SetInputData(VtkDeformedImage);
ImageToPolydata0->Update();
vtkSmartPointer<vtkImageDataGeometryFilter> ImageToPolydata1 = vtkSmartPointer<vtkImageDataGeometryFilter>::New();
ImageToPolydata1->SetInputData(VtkDeformedImage);
ImageToPolydata1->Update();
vtkSmartPointer<vtkAppendPolyData> appendFilt
VTK 9.0 一个简单的可视化例子:两个polydata 显示在同一个render Window 中
最新推荐文章于 2024-03-25 12:55:44 发布